Katie Britt to face Mo Brooks in runoff, Governor Ivey rolls easily and more on Alabama Politics This Week …

Radio talk show host Dale Jackson and 256Today CEO Mecca Musick take you through Alabama’s biggest political stories, including:

— Is Katie Britt the clear favorite for U.S. Senate?

— Was Governor Kay Ivey ever in danger?

— What can be done after yet another school shooting?

Yellowhammer News’ Dylan Smith joins the show to discuss how Election Day played out and everything happening in Alabama politics this week.

Jackson closes the show with a “Parting Shot” directed at Alabama’s low voter turnout while other states are seeing higher turnout.
